A Class B contractor license typically allows individuals or companies to perform general contracting work, which includes managing and overseeing construction projects that involve two or more trades, such as Plumbing, electrical, and framing. This license often requires meeting specific experience and education requirements, passing an exam, and demonstrating knowledge of building codes and regulations. Class B contractors can work on projects that exceed a certain monetary threshold, which varies by state or jurisdiction. Each state may have its own specific requirements and classifications, so it's essential to check local regulations for precise information.

To verify a contractor's license online, visit the state licensing board's website and look for a contractor license lookup tool. Enter the contractor's information to check if their license is valid and up to date.
